Mount Pleasant is one of Vancouver's most creative and sought-after East Side neighbourhoods, bounded by Cambie Street, Clark Drive, West Broadway, and False Creek. Its commercial heart runs along Main Street and Kingsway - a dense, walkable strip of independent cafes, restaurants, craft breweries, and vintage and design shops - while Jonathan Rogers Park and Mount Pleasant Park add green space. Once industrial, it's now a mix of heritage homes, character apartments, and new mid-rise development, with the False Creek Flats and Emily Carr University at its northern edge. The False Creek seawall, Olympic Village, and Science World are a short walk north, and the Main Street-Science World and Olympic Village SkyTrain stations link downtown and the airport.
